PROCEDURE
实验过程
0.700 g (1.42 mmol) of 3-benzyloxypropyl)triphenylphosphonium bromide, 0.305 g (1.18 mmol) of trans-(4-formyl-cyclohexylmethyl)-methyl-carbamic acid tert-butyl ester (example 1.2) and 0.662 g of finely milled potassium carbonate were suspended in 10.0 ml of 2-methyl-2-butanol and the reaction mixture intensively stirred at 100° C. for 2 hours. It was then evaporated, poured into 50 ml of an ice/water mixture and extracted 3 times with 50 ml of ethylacetate. The combined ethylacetate phases were dried over magnesium sulfate and evaporated under reduced pressure. The residue formed was chromatographed on silica gel with a 95:5 v/v mixture of dichloromethane and ether as the eluent giving 0.364 g (78.6%) trans-[4-(4-benzyloxy-[E/Z 1:9]but-1-enyl)-cyclohexylmethyl]-methyl-carbamic acid tert-butyl ester as colorless viscous oil, MS: 331 [M−C4H8)+].
